I have several iso images on disk and a script that vnconfig's the files then mount -t cd9660's them. The results are then seen as shares via samba to windows clients (albeit read-only). This (and ``make release'') has caused me no problems - in -current & -stable. > - Jordan -- Brian , , Don't _EVER_ lose your sense of humour....
